    A 401(k) is a savings vehicle established by a business or self-employed person to help employees and business owners save for retirement as well as take advantage of the tax benefits provided to both the business owner and employees. The flexible features of a 401(k) can accommodate the needs of a broad range of retirement planning objectives. Each individual gets to choose how much of their pay will be deposited into their 401(k) account each pay period – before taxes are deducted and how those dollars will be invested. Many businesses choose to match a portion of the employees’ contributions, helping retirement savings grow even faster. In addition to providing financial security in retirement, saving in a 401(k) provides tax advantages for both the business owner and the employees, including tax deductions, tax-deferred earnings, and tax credits. For example, when an employee saves in a 401(k), their contribution is deducted from their paycheck before income taxes are withheld.

    Lenme is a peer-to-peer lending platform that connects borrowers seeking quick personal loans or cash advances with financial institutions, lending businesses, and individual investors interested in the smaller loan market. By leveraging technology, Lenme eliminates unnecessary costs, providing borrowers with transparent and immediate access to capital, while offering lenders the same data and tools typically available to large financial institutions. Borrowers can request loans ranging from $50 to $5,000 through a simple three-click process, specifying the desired amount and repayment period. Lenders then compete to offer the most favorable interest rates, regardless of the borrower's credit score. For investors, Lenme provides access to over 2,000 data points on each borrower, including credit reports, banking data, income, and payment history, enabling informed investment decisions.
